Authorities in Doda have initiated an investigation following the circulation of a viral video that allegedly shows posters featuring Asim Munir and Shehbaz Sharif being pasted in parts of the region. The video has attracted significant attention on social media, prompting officials to verify its authenticity.
According to police sources, preliminary observations suggest that the video may have been manipulated or edited. Officials have stated that a detailed technical examination is underway to determine whether the visuals are genuine or digitally altered. Cyber experts are also being consulted as part of the verification process.
The circulation of such content has raised concerns among authorities regarding public order and the potential spread of misinformation. Police have urged citizens to avoid sharing unverified content and to rely on official sources for accurate information. They emphasized that spreading misleading videos can create unnecessary panic and confusion.
As part of the investigation, officials are working to identify the origin of the video and those responsible for its creation and distribution. If the content is found to be fabricated, appropriate legal action is expected to be taken against individuals involved. Authorities have reiterated that strict measures will be implemented to address any attempt to disturb peace in the region.
Local administration has also increased monitoring of social media platforms to track the spread of the video and prevent further circulation. Law enforcement agencies are coordinating with relevant departments to ensure that the situation remains under control.
